Title :
Improvements on Trust Transitivity Model for Open Network

Abstract :
Traditional security mechanisms have not met with the needs of open network. Trust mechanism will be an important trend in the field of security. Present studies still have some kinds of deficiency. In this paper, Further works are done in trust transitivity model. As an important factor, recommendation ability ("honesty") is considered to take part in computing recommendation trust value. Trust storage structures about "honesty" and "accuracy" are provided, which are based on n history windows and are renewed with time goes on. New trust transitivity tree is studied, which has made differentiation from "honesty" and "accuracy". Finally, a recursion-arithmetic about trust transitivity is given. Experimentation results show novel trust model is rational, correct and valid.
